What We Consider For Historic Home Roof Repair
We look at roof type, age, access, neighboring rooflines, documentation needs, drainage, prior repairs, and what must be monitored after the visit.
Older Frederick homes in the Carroll Creek area and the East Street corridor commonly have original brick construction with chimneys that have been flashed and re-flashed multiple times. The counterflashing on these properties often shows three or four generations of repair, some using lead, some galvanized steel, some caulk. Understanding what has been done before helps us make a repair that will last rather than adding another layer of temporary fix. For properties in the city's historic district, we are also mindful of what the exterior should look like when the work is done.
